Position Overview

Highspot Sales Enablement = IT Service Professional

The IT Service Professional will be responsible for day-to-day activities related to effectively creating, maintaining, and supporting CRM business processes, systems, and documenting business requirements for IT Sales / Digital Marketing. The business analyst must be able to communicate equally with business owners, users, and IT professionals. Candidates must have a solid understanding Sales Enablement Automation, as well as the ability to document business needs through business requirements that will drive technical solutions. This role will serve as facilitator, analyst, and problem solver. Excellent analytical skills and the ability to work collaboratively in a team environment are essential, as are outstanding communication and interpersonal skills. He/she will align with global, division and business unit strategies and business requirements.
